A leading cultural heritage institution is seeking a technician for a part-time position coordinating research in the Virtual Museum project. The role involves designing exhibits, conducting research, and supporting courses on intangible heritage. Candidates should have a degree in Social Anthropology and experience in ethnographic research.

Offer Description
The technician will coordinate research activities for the Virtual Museum project of the PATRIM 4.0 initiative.
Responsibilities include designing exhibition areas, preparing texts, conducting documentary research (photos, videos, interviews), and supporting other project elements such as training courses on intangible heritage and scientific conferences.
Gross salary per year : €10,897.05.
The application period is from June 3 to June 17, 2025.

Additional Information
The selection process involves an interview, scored from 0 to 10, with a minimum passing score of 5. The interview assesses suitability, experience, skills, communication, and motivation. The process will likely be conducted online.
The employment duration is 10 months, ending by 01 / 06 / 2026. Candidates must accept the offer within 5 working days of notification.
Priority is given to candidates with disabilities (Law 89 / 2015, 2% quota).
The official start date depends on administrative procedures.
